#!/bin/bash
#####################################################################################
# #
# Syntax: fixcerts DOMAIN #
# #
# Use: Extend Letsencrypt SSl certificates for commonly grouped services such as #
# Apache,Postfix,Dovecot using Certbot. Useful for keeping all client #
# applications referencing the same virtual domain name, such as auto-config #
# email clients on phones, i.e. mailuser@mydomain.TLD smtp.mydomain.TLD #
# imaps.mydomain.TLD instead of mailuser@mydomain.TLD mail.ISPmaildomain.TLD #
# Also useful when sending mail through services like Gmail that will #
# validate sender through a negotiated TLS encrypted connection. #
# #
# Ex: sh fixcerts myhosteddomain.com #
# #
# Prerequisites: #
# - A Letsencrypt certificate for the DOMAIN must already exist #
# - A seperate certificate each for Dovecot and Postfix were previously generated #
# - All new host names to add MUST already exist in DNS at least as a CNAME #
# - Edit the Dovecot/Postfix conf to use the alternate certificate #
# - Set the variable wr_file to a directory that certbot can read and write from #
# - Set the dom_cert=,dv_cert=,pf_cert=,dv_file=, and pf_file= variables #
# #
# In my case, I ran: #
# certbot certonly -webroot /usr/local/ispconfig/interface/acme -d dc.hrst.xyz #
# certbot certonly -webroot /usr/local/ispconfig/interface/acme -d pf.hrst.xyz #
# to create the separate Dovecot and Postscript certificates, then edited and #
# ran the script to extend those certificate, once per hosted domain #
# #
# If you use only one alternate certifcate for both mail services, set both dv_file #
# and pf_file to the same file name and set one of _cert files="" and #
# use the other. If you don't wish to add to a particular certificate, set the #
# variable ="", such as dom_cert #
# TODO: Pre-validate desired additions as already existing in DNS #
# Generate SRV Records and add to DNS to autoconfig clients #
# #
# Author: tad.hasse@gmail.com #
# #
#####################################################################################
#bail out on error
set -e
# Hostnames to add to the main domain certificate
dom_cert="webmail"
# Hostnames to add to the Dovecot domain certificate
dv_cert="pop3s imap"
# Hostnames to add to the Postfix domain certificate
pf_cert="mail smtp smtps"
# Name of the certificate file that handles Dovecot
dv_file="dc.hrst.xyz"
# Name of the certificate file that handles Postfix
pf_file="pf.hrst.xyz"
# Writeable webroot for certbot (I use ISPConfig,
wr_file="/usr/local/ispconfig/interface/acme"
new_cert=""
nanobot=""
affected_services=""
if [ -z "$1" ] # Is parameter #1 zero length?
then
echo "-No DOMAIN specified" # Or no parameter passed.
exit 1
fi
#live_check='/etc/letsencrypt/live/'$1
if [[ ! -d '/etc/letsencrypt/live/'$1 ]]; then
echo "- DOMAIN certificate for \"$1\" not found -"
exit 1
fi
if [[ ! -d '/etc/letsencrypt/live/'${dv_file} ]]; then
echo "- Dovecot/postoffice certificate" ${dv_file}" for \"$1\" not found -"
exit 1
fi
if [[ ! -d '/etc/letsencrypt/live/'${pf_file} ]]; then
echo "- Postfix/mail certificate" ${pf_file}" for \"$1\" not found -"
exit 1
fi
# Have certbot generate its current certificate list for use as input
certbot certificates >~/certfile
# Extend base domain certificate which typically only contains the domain.TLD and www.domain.TLD
if [[ ! -z "${dom_cert}" ]]; then
echo
new_cert=$(echo $dom_cert| sed -e "s/ /.$1 /g" -e 's/ / -d /g' -e "s/$/.$1 /g" -e 's/^/-d /g')
echo "Adding" ${new_cert} " to "$1
nanobot=$(grep -A1 "Certificate Name: "$1 certfile |awk -F': ' '{ {getline}; $1=""; print }'|sed 's/ / -d /g')
doit_cert=$(echo "certbot certonly --webroot -w ${wr_file}${nanobot} ${new_cert}")
${doit_cert}
affected_services=${affected_services}+"A"
else
echo "Domain Certificate unaffected"
fi
# Extend the Dovecot certificate
if [[ ! -z "${dv_cert}" ]]; then
echo
new_cert=$(echo $dv_cert| sed -e "s/ /.$1 /g" -e 's/ / -d /g' -e "s/$/.$1 /g" -e 's/^/-d /g')
echo "Adding" ${new_cert} " to "${dv_file}
nanobot=$(grep -A1 "Certificate Name: "${dv_file} certfile |awk -F': ' '{ {getline}; $1=""; print }'|sed 's/ / -d /g')
doit_cert=$(echo "certbot certonly --webroot -w ${wr_file}${nanobot} ${new_cert}")
${doit_cert}
affected_services=${affected_services}+"D"
else
echo "Dovecot Certificate unaffected"
fi
# Extend the Postscript certificate
if [[ ! -z "{$pf_cert}" ]]; then
echo
new_cert=$(echo $pf_cert| sed -e "s/ /.$1 /g" -e 's/ / -d /g' -e "s/$/.$1 /g" -e 's/^/-d /g')
echo "Adding" ${new_cert} " to " ${pf_file}
nanobot=$(grep -A1 "Certificate Name: "${pf_file} certfile |awk -F': ' '{ {getline}; $1=""; print }'|sed 's/ / -d /g')
doit_cert=$(echo "certbot certonly --webroot -w ${wr_file}${nanobot} ${new_cert}")
${doit_cert}
affected_services=${affected_services}+"P"
else
echo "Postfix Certificate unaffected"
fi
if [[ $affected_services == *"A"* ]]; then
echo "Remember to restart the httpd service"
fi
if [[ $affected_services == *"D"* ]]; then
echo "Remember to restart the dovecot/postoffice service"
fi
if [[ $affected_services == *"P"* ]]; then
echo "Remember to restart the postfix/sendmail service"
fi
echo
echo
echo "Add the following SRV records to DNS for client setup for "$1
if [[ $affected_services == *"D"* ]]; then
echo "_imaps._tcp."$1 "SRV 3600 4 60 993 imaps"
echo "_pop3s._tcp."$1 "SRV 3600 6 60 995 pop3s"
echo "_imap._tcp."$1 " SRV 3600 8 60 143 imap"
fi
if [[ $affected_services == *"P"* ]]; then
echo "_smtps._tcp."$1 "SRV 3600 8 60 465 smtps"
echo "_smtp._tcp."$1 " SRV 3600 10 60 587 smtp"
fi
